Kugelis recipe
Savor the rich, comforting flavors of Lithuanian kugelis!
Ingredients
- 800 g potatoes
- 1 onion
- 200 g bacon
- 3 eggs
- 250 ml milk
- 100 g flour
- 1 tsp salt
- 0.5 tsp black pepper
- 50 g butter
How to make Kugelis
- Preheat the oven to 180°C (350°F).
- Grate 1 kg of potatoes and 1 onion finely, then place in a clean cloth and squeeze out excess moisture.
- Cook 200 g of chopped bacon in a skillet over medium heat until crispy, about 5 minutes. Remove from heat and set aside.
- In a mixing bowl, whisk together 3 eggs, 250 ml of milk, 100 g of flour, 1 teaspoon of salt, and ½ teaspoon of black pepper until combined.
- Add the crispy bacon, grated potatoes, and onion to the egg mixture and stir gently until just combined.
- Pour the combined mixture into a greased baking dish, spreading it evenly across the bottom.
- Place in the preheated oven and bake for 1 hour, or until golden brown and firm to the touch.
- Remove from the oven and let it rest for a few minutes before slicing into portions and serving.
What is Kugelis?
Kugelis is a traditional dish from Lithuania. It takes about 120 minutes to prepare, is considered medium to make at home, and uses 9 ingredients.
